Output 0054a0eaddced35e5f365187891ab3a35fc098b05cce0b9617538efc1885594f:7

value
27370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c53e2da1441007f858665db911348bcae356a3c OP_EQUAL
address
3A7CahkKTUPBS7MUKVXR8GXakGXuwFLs2r
transaction
0054a0eaddced35e5f365187891ab3a35fc098b05cce0b9617538efc1885594f
confirmations
500265
spent
true